Commit d60766cb authored by Guolin Ke's avatar Guolin Ke
Browse files

support the team name in wandb projct

parent 5abf13c3
...@@ -313,8 +313,13 @@ class TensorboardProgressBarWrapper(BaseProgressBar): ...@@ -313,8 +313,13 @@ class TensorboardProgressBarWrapper(BaseProgressBar):
global _wandb_inited global _wandb_inited
if not _wandb_inited and wandb_project and wandb_available: if not _wandb_inited and wandb_project and wandb_available:
wandb_name = args.wandb_name or wandb.util.generate_id() wandb_name = args.wandb_name or wandb.util.generate_id()
if "/" in wandb_project:
entity, project = wandb_project.split("/")
else:
entity, project = None, wandb_project
wandb.init( wandb.init(
project=wandb_project, project=project,
entity=entity,
name=wandb_name, name=wandb_name,
config=vars(args), config=vars(args),
id=wandb_name, id=wandb_name,
......
...@@ -175,7 +175,7 @@ def get_parser(desc, default_task="test"): ...@@ -175,7 +175,7 @@ def get_parser(desc, default_task="test"):
help='path to save logs for tensorboard, should match --logdir ' help='path to save logs for tensorboard, should match --logdir '
'of running tensorboard (default: no tensorboard logging)') 'of running tensorboard (default: no tensorboard logging)')
parser.add_argument('--wandb-project', metavar='DIR', default='', parser.add_argument('--wandb-project', metavar='DIR', default='',
help='name of wandb project, empty for no wandb logging, for wandb login, use env WANDB_API_KEY') help='name of wandb project, empty for no wandb logging, for wandb login, use env WANDB_API_KEY. You can also use team_name/project_name for project name.')
parser.add_argument('--wandb-name', metavar='DIR', default='', parser.add_argument('--wandb-name', metavar='DIR', default='',
help='wandb run/id name, empty for no wandb logging, for wandb login, use env WANDB_API_KEY') help='wandb run/id name, empty for no wandb logging, for wandb login, use env WANDB_API_KEY')
parser.add_argument('--seed', default=1, type=int, metavar='N', parser.add_argument('--seed', default=1, type=int, metavar='N',
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ment